Who buys the Queen Vic from Chrissie?

In 2005, Ian Beale impulsively buys The Queen Vic from Chrissie Watts at a knockdown price after she kills Den Watts. However, the sale is later deemed invalid because Chrissie forged the signatures on the transfer documents. Consequently, the pub is actually inherited by Sharon Watts, who signs it over to Peggy Mitchell.

Do they drink real beer in EastEnders?

EastEnders uses various made up alcohol brands to avoid Product Placement. The Queen Vic is notorious for serving Jenkins' Lager, both on tap and in a bottle. There have also been other beers and ales shown.

Why did Laila Morse change her name?

Laila Morse is her stage name. Her real name is Maureen Oldman. It was Isabella Rossellini who suggested the name 'Laila Morse' as it's an anagram of 'mia sorella' - Italian for 'my sister'. Gary Oldman was dating Rossellini at the time.
